Reds learn provisional fixtures for July

Sunday 07 June 2020 19:29

Manchester United's six Premier League fixtures in July have now been given provisional dates, all of which are subject to change for live TV coverage.

As is the case in June, the UK kick-off times for the televised games, when they are announced in due course, will differ from the traditional slots.

Next month is due to begin with a home game against Bournemouth - pencilled in for Saturday 4 July - and end with a trip to Leicester City on Sunday 26 July. The latter match would be our 38th and final one of this interrupted 2019/20 Premier League campaign.

Between those encounters with the Cherries and the Foxes, the Reds will visit Aston Villa, host Southampton, travel to Crystal Palace and welcome West Ham United for our last home game of the season.

All of the fixtures will be played behind closed doors and are subject to safety requirements being in place.
The provisional scheduling of July's fixtures follows Friday's confirmation that United will restart by playing Spurs away on Friday 19 June, and then take on Sheffield United at home on Wednesday 24 June, before closing out this month at Brighton & Hove Albion on Tuesday 30 June.

UNITED'S REMAINING PREMIER LEAGUE FIXTURES 2019/20*

19 June - Tottenham (A) 20:15
24 June - Sheffield Utd (H) 18:00
30 June - Brighton (A) 20:15
4 July - Bournemouth (H)
8 July - Aston Villa (A)
11 July - Southampton (H)
15 July - Crystal Palace (A)
18 July - West Ham (H)
26 July - Leicester City (A)

*June kick-offs are in UK time. July match dates subject to change.
